public class CollectionCrawler extends PDSProductCrawler
inPersistanceMode, touchedFiles
DIR_FILTER, FILE_FILTER, LOG
Constructor and Description |
---|
CollectionCrawler(Pds4MetExtractorConfig extractorConfig)
Constructor.
|
Modifier and Type | Method and Description |
---|---|
void |
crawl(File collection)
Crawl a PDS4 collection file.
|
protected boolean |
generateDoc(File product,
gov.nasa.jpl.oodt.cas.metadata.Metadata productMetadata) |
addAction, addActions, addKnownMetadata, getActions, getMetadataForProduct, getMetExtractorConfig, passesPreconditions, setDirectoryFilter, setFileFilter, setInPersistanceMode, setMetExtractorConfig
clearIngestStatus, crawl, createProduct, getIngestStatus, getSearchDocGenerator, handleFile, setActionRepo, setSearchDocGenerator
addRequiredMetadata, getActionIds, getApplicationContext, getDaemonPort, getDaemonWait, getFilemgrUrl, getGlobalMetadata, getId, getIngester, getProductPath, getRequiredMetadata, isCrawlForDirs, isNoRecur, isSkipIngest, setActionIds, setApplicationContext, setCrawlForDirs, setDaemonPort, setDaemonWait, setFilemgrUrl, setGlobalMetadata, setId, setIngester, setNoRecur, setProductPath, setRequiredMetadata, setSkipIngest
public CollectionCrawler(Pds4MetExtractorConfig extractorConfig)
extractorConfig
- A configuration class for the metadata
extractor.public void crawl(File collection)
crawl
in class PDSProductCrawler
collection
- The PDS4 Collection file.protected boolean generateDoc(File product, gov.nasa.jpl.oodt.cas.metadata.Metadata productMetadata)
generateDoc
in class ProductCrawler
Copyright © 2010–2018 Planetary Data System. All rights reserved.